2|Technical data
2.1 Technical data of the entire system
2.1.1 General system data*
Description
Length (mm) 2950
Width (mm) 1900
Height (mm) 1540
Height, hood open (mm) 2060
Weight (kg) 1700
Paint finish RAL 7035 / RAL 7016
*The technical drawings for this machine can be found in the annex of this operat-
ing manual.
2.1.2 Pneumatics
Designation
Minimum input pressure (bar) 6

2.1.6 Safety devices
Designation
Main switch Lockable
Emergency STOP pushbutton (pieces) 3
Exhaust air duct monitoring With differential pressure switch
Hood Release via hardware / software safety
switch
2.1.7 Electrical data of the entire system
2.1.7.1 Connection data*
Description
Mains voltage 5-wire system N/PE (V) 3 x 230 V / 400 V
Voltage tolerance (%) ± 10
Mains frequency (Hz) 50 / 60
Pre-fuse (A, delayed action)* 3 x 125
Power consumption (kW)* 30
Nominal current consumption (A)* 50
*Depending on the respective development stage. The actual values are specified
on the type plate of your soldering system.
